Department of Energy (DOE) has issued an order authorizing Floridian Natural Gas Storage Company, LLC, (Floridian) to export LNG produced at Floridian’s proposed liquefaction and storage facility in Martin County, Fla., and transported via ISO containers on trucks for ultimate export via ocean-going vessels to nations with a Free Trade Agreement (FTA) with the United States. On July 15, 2015, Algonquin Gas Transmission, LLC (“Algonquin”) filed proposed revisions to its Tariff to adopt a pro forma Multiple Shipper Option Agreement (“MSOA”), which would give multiple customers the ability to share interstate pipeline capacity by entering into a single firm transportation service agreement.
